mysql跟sqlserver哪个简单易上手

对于初学者来说,MySQL 比 SQL Server 更简单易用,主要有以下原因: 学习曲线更平坦。
MySQL语法设计直观、接近自然语言(如英语),核心概念(如数据表、查询语句)易于理解。
即使没有编程背景,初学者也能很快掌握基本操作。
SQL Server的语法更加复杂,包含更多高级功能(例如复杂的存储过程和高级数据类型),需要更长的时间来适应。
安装和配置更容易。
MySQL支持跨平台运行(Windows/Linux/macOS)。
安装包体积小,配置过程高度自动化,并有直观的图形化工具(如MySQL Workbench)辅助安装。
SQLServer的安装包较大,对硬件要求较高。
配置很复杂,尤其是在非 Windows 系统上。
标准GUI工具(SSMS)功能丰富,但操作门槛较高。
社区支持更加积极。
MySQL拥有全球最大的开源数据库社区之一,有详细的官方文档,第三方教程、论坛和问答平台(如StackOverflow)资源丰富,初学者可以快速找到解决方案。
SQLServer 社区很小。
虽然微软官方提供了支持,但针对初学者的入门资源相对分散,解决问题的效率可能较低。
基本功能全面覆盖。
MySQL虽然定位为轻量级数据库,但已经满足了大多数初学者的学习需求(如数据的增删改查、表关系的设计),并且具有很强的扩展性。
SQL Server的高级功能(如分区表、AlwaysOn高可用)更适合企业级场景,初学者短期内很难接触到。
SQL Server目前的场景:如果初学者打算将来从事Windows生态开发(例如.NET平台),需要企业级功能(例如集成BI工具),或者更喜欢微软的技术栈,可以逐步学习SQL Server。
优点包括: 强大的 GUI 工具:SSMS 提供可视化数据库设计、性能监控和调试功能。
深度集成:与Windows系统和Azure云服务无缝协作,适合企业环境。
高级特性:支持复杂事务处理、安全审计等企业级需求。
总结 初学者应该优先考虑MySQL。
门槛低,快速建立数据库基本概念;掌握核心技能后,可以根据需要扩展SQL Server等企业级数据库。

想学习数据库 不知道SQLserver 、Oracle、 Mysql、 DB2那个比较主流,使用比较多,各自的优点是什么

开源特性并在互联网公司中广泛使用。
尽管DB2 具有优越的性能,但它的用途是有限的。
建议根据个人职业规划和培训机会进行选择。

sqlserver和mysql区别

区别如下: 1 、开源MySQL是一个开源关系数据库管理系统(RDBMS);而SQLServer不是开源的而是商业的。
2 .编程 MySQL主要使用C和C++编程语言进行编程。
SQLServer主要是用C++编写的,但也有一些组件是用C语言编写的。
3 .平台 SQLServer仅支持Linux和Windows平台,主要用于.Net应用程序或Windows项目。
相比之下,MySQL支持很多平台,主要用于PHP项目或应用程序。
4 .语法 MySQL的语法有点复杂。
SQLServer 语法更简单且更易于使用。
5 . 在MySQL 中执行查询。
查询一旦执行,就不能半途而废。
在SQL Server中,查询可以在执行后中途取消。
6 、存储引擎MySQL;有多种存储引擎可以让开发者根据性能更灵活地使用表引擎。
InnoDB 是一种流行的存储引擎。
SQLServer可以使用一种或仅一种存储引擎。